Titlagarh is a Municipality in Balangir district of the Indian state of Odisha. It is a known summer hotspot in India due its extreme heatwaves and was among the top 10 Indian cities with maximum temperature in 2022.{{Cite web|url=https://www.dnaindia.com/india/report-imd-releases-list-of-cities-with-highest-maximum-temperatures-2958997|title=Top 10 Indian cities with maximum temperature in 2022|website=DNA India}}
Geography and Climate
Titilagarh is located at {{Coord|20.3|N|83.15|E|}}.{{Cite web|url=http://www.fallingrain.com/world/IN/21/Titlagarh.html|title=Maps, Weather, and Airports for Titlagarh, India|website=www.fallingrain.com}} It has an average elevation of 215 metres (705 feet).

Demographics
{{As of|2001}} India census,{{cite web|url=http://www.censusindia.net/results/town.php?stad=A&state5=999|archive-url=https://web.archive.org/web/20040616075334/http://www.censusindia.net/results/town.php?stad=A&state5=999|archive-date=16 June 2004|title= Census of India 2001: Data from the 2001 Census, including cities, villages and towns (Provisional)|access-date=2008-11-01|publisher= Census Commission of India}} Titilagarh had a population of 27,756. Males constitute 52% of the population and females 48%. Titilagarh has an average literacy rate of 67%, higher than the national average of 59.5%: male literacy is 75%, and female literacy is 57%. In Titilagarh, 12% of the population is under 6 years of age.
Transport
Titilagarh Junction railway station is a junction on the Jharsuguda - Vizianagaram line and Raipur - Vizianagaram line. Through this it is connected to all major cities of India. It was one of the major railway stations in the Sambalpur Railway Division under East Coast Railway Zone.
Titilagarh is near to NH-59 (previously known as NH-217), which runs between Gopalpur in Odisha and Raipur in Chhattisgarh. There is a state highway between Titilagarh and Balangir district via Saintala and between Titilagarh and Bhawanipatana via Sindhekela.
